What is a 30-Foot Shipping Container?
A 30-foot shipping container is a medium-sized [30' Container New](https://hack.allmende.io/s/ZBwJiLHDG), generally made from [30ft Steel Containers](https://love.ynlma.com/home.php?mod=space&uid=380920), that provides a robust and water tight solution for transporting numerous types of cargo. It normally measures 30 feet in length, 8 feet in width, and 8.5 feet in height, although variations exist depending upon the manufacturer. Due to its distinct measurements, this container is frequently seen as a bridge in between smaller sized and larger containers, accommodating companies that require additional area without the immense bulk of a 40-foot container.

30-foot containers are utilized throughout numerous sectors for varied functions. Below is a list of their most typical applications:
Mobile Offices: Many organizations transform these containers into onsite workplaces and work areas, especially in construction websites and remote areas.Storage Solutions: Their moderate size enables them to function as storage systems for companies or residential needs, offering sufficient space for seasonal products or inventory overflow.Short-term Housing: In catastrophe relief scenarios, these containers can be converted into momentary living areas, offering important shelter and security.Retail Spaces: Entrepreneurs often use 30-foot containers as pop-up stores or kiosks, leveraging the mobility and special looks of shipping containers.Workshops: Hobbyists and little services can transform these containers into workshops for crafts, repairs, or light manufacturing.Advantages of 30-Foot Containers

While 30-foot containers provide many advantages, there are some factors to think about before dedicating to a purchase or leasing:
Cost: Prices can vary based upon condition (new vs. used) and modifications (e.g., insulation, windows). Prospective purchasers should compare prices from different suppliers.Schedule: Depending on the market, 30-foot containers may be less readily available than standard sizes, like 20-foot and 40-foot containers.Zoning Regulations: Before releasing a [30ft Container](https://pads.zapf.in/s/rrlsAHaeNH) for industrial usage, consult regional zoning laws and guidelines to ensure compliance.Transport Logistics: Although 30-foot containers are generally simpler to carry than their larger equivalents, planning logistics for website access and shipment is vital.Table 2: Pros and Cons of 30-Foot Shipping ContainersProsConsIdeal size for tighter spacesAvailable alternatives may differCost-efficient compared to larger sizesMay require adjustments for specific usagesLong lasting and weather-resistantResale value can varyVersatile for multiple applicationsProspective zoning problemsEasier to transferLess common than standard sizesFAQ About 30-Foot Containers
